Ibrahima Konate's next club appears to have been revealed after he failed to agree a new contract with Liverpool.

Throughout the 2026 season Liverpool fans have raised questions over the future of star defender Konate ahead of his current deal expiring in June.

At the start of the season the Frenchman was heavily linked with several major European sides, including Real Madrid, despite Liverpool offering him new terms.

However, his disappointing form at the start of the campaign soon saw these links lessen, with talks over a new Liverpool contract believed to be progressing as the season went on.

In April, the 27-year-old hinted that a deal was close, saying "There are many things people have said but for a long time we have spoken with the club and we are close to an agreement.

"For sure, there is a big chance that I'm here next season. This is what I've always wanted."

It therefore came as a surprise when it was reported that Konate would not be extending his deal and would therefore be leaving Liverpool in the coming weeks.

Naturally, this has again raised questions about what could be next for the centre-back, and it appears we may already have an answer.

Ibrahima Konate's next club revealed

According to a report from the Daily Mail, despite the previous reports linking him to the Bernabeu, Paris Saint-Germain is now the most likely destination for Konate this summer.

Although the French giants, who are currently preparing for their second consecutive Champions League final, already boast a formidable back line that includes Marquinhos, Willian Pacho and Illia Zabarnyi.

Therefore adding Konate to their ranks would make the French champions and even more impressive side, with the Liverpool star also believed to be eager on the move.

Joining PSG would allow Konate to move back to Paris, the City of his birth, and reunite with his PSG-supporting family in the French capital after representing his country at the upcoming World Cup in the USA, Mexico and Canada.

Konate was previously linked with PSG in the summer of 2024 ahead of Euro 2024, but despite him admitting it was a 'logical' move, he made it clear that he was happy at Liverpool and the move never materialised.

“It's a little logical because I was born in France and Paris. I have six big brothers and all six support PSG I think, at least four or five at least," Konate said while on international duty with France.

"We watched a lot of games together, they already brought me back to the younger stadium before I went to the training centre."
